  "textContent": "The present application and the resultant patent provide a waste heat recovery system (100) for recovering heat from a number of turbocharger stages (210). The waste heat recovery system (100) may include a simple organic rankine cycle system (110) and a number of charge air coolers (220) in communication with the turbocharger stages (210) and the simple organic rankine cycle system (110). The charge air coolers (220) are positioned in a number of parallel branches (270) of the simple organic rankine cycle system (110).",
